Recommendation for Training Meetings and Call Sharing Nierman Practice Managment

Summary: Provided are the recommended steps to start/share/schedule a meeting internally while making and sharing outbound calls outside of organization.

Schedule the Meeting in Outlook (Can scheduled immediately)

Lauch and select Outlook calendar from left navigation bar in Outlook

Double click to Open New Calendar event. This will activate view to add new calendar event.

Add Title (Name that means something pertaining to meeting event)

Invite attendees- Select Optional Button. This will activate view add team members. Invite required or optional.

Important: Toggle radio button to Teams Meeting

What the recipient See’s

 A notification banner alert is received to the recipient’s desktop (If made mandatory) will be required to make selection to join or opt out. 

 The organizers meeting specifics are shown when meeting is opened. From here, the recipient (Team member) select: Join the meeting now link to start/join the meeting.

Internal MSTeams Meeting has started, important now to begin actual Phone Call using Ring Central Telcom app (At current) to initiate a call outside of organization.

Begin Call to internal Team Members (Outbound then to contacts)

**IMPORTANT**
Mute Mic Button in Teams Meeting so that true audio can be dedicated to the call outside of organization with best of call quality.

Meeting organizer from above executes call to team member, each, and adds accordingly.

Select team members from Contacts list in Telecom Application (Ring Central) and Add call.

Next, begin adding internal team members, Select the Merge Button activated. This will tie first call to next, to next and so on. Repeat steps until all internal members have been added to call and meeting organizer is sharing desktop or another member from Teams meeting.

 Lastly, once all members confirmed added to call, now add external out of organization number and begin training processes.
